From 209820bab8fd5f73b3c597c8d118a503d1b8bc21 Mon Sep 17 00:00:00 2001 From: Pauli Virtanen Date: Sun, 16 Feb 2025 18:13:52 +0200 Subject: [PATCH] bluez5: add separate BAP sink/source/duplex profiles If device supports duplex, show also separate sink-only/source-only profiles. Devices don't necessarily support high-quality audio in duplex profile, so add sink/source only profiles. This is also a workaround for the current situation that devices may signal duplex support, but the attempted duplex configuration fails to work. --- spa/plugins/bluez5/bluez5-device.c | 155 ++++++++++++++++++++++------- 1 file changed, 117 insertions(+), 38 deletions(-) diff --git a/spa/plugins/bluez5/bluez5-device.c b/spa/plugins/bluez5/bluez5-device.c index 9813d2725..f0bbc6bb8 100644 --- a/spa/plugins/bluez5/bluez5-device.c +++ b/spa/plugins/bluez5/bluez5-device.c @@ -53,13 +53,15 @@ static struct spa_i18n *_i18n; #define _(_str) spa_i18n_text(_i18n,(_str)) #define N_(_str) (_str) -enum { +enum device_profile { DEVICE_PROFILE_OFF = 0, - DEVICE_PROFILE_AG = 1, - DEVICE_PROFILE_A2DP = 2, - DEVICE_PROFILE_HSP_HFP = 3, - DEVICE_PROFILE_BAP = 4, - DEVICE_PROFILE_ASHA = 5, + DEVICE_PROFILE_AG, + DEVICE_PROFILE_A2DP, + DEVICE_PROFILE_HSP_HFP, + DEVICE_PROFILE_BAP, + DEVICE_PROFILE_BAP_SINK, + DEVICE_PROFILE_BAP_SOURCE, + DEVICE_PROFILE_ASHA, DEVICE_PROFILE_LAST, }; @@ -185,6 +187,19 @@ static void init_node(struct impl *this, struct node *node, uint32_t id) } } +static bool profile_is_bap(enum device_profile profile) +{ + switch (profile) { + case DEVICE_PROFILE_BAP: + case DEVICE_PROFILE_BAP_SINK: + case DEVICE_PROFILE_BAP_SOURCE: + return true; + default: + break; + } + return false; +} + static void get_media_codecs(struct impl *this, enum spa_bluetooth_audio_codec id, const struct media_codec **codecs, size_t size) { const struct media_codec * const *c; @@ -250,20 +265,6 @@ static bool is_bap_client(struct impl *this) return false; } -static bool can_bap_codec_switch(struct impl *this) -{ - if (!is_bap_client(this)) - return false; - - /* XXX: codec switching for source/duplex is not currently - * XXX: implemented properly.
